Воспроизвести журналы Ruby on Rails, включая параметры и информацию о сеансе? - PullRequest
2 голосов
/ 24 февраля 2011

JMeter Access Log Sampler требует общих журналов формата журнала для воспроизведения http-запросов.Я хочу использовать его для воспроизведения действий в приложении Rails из журнала, включая передачу параметров.Есть ли способ сделать это с JMeter или любым другим инструментом?Я полагаю, я мог бы проанализировать журналы в curl запросах, но может ли таким образом поддерживать информацию о сеансе (отслеживая, какой пользователь выполнил какое действие)?

Редактировать Я должен сказать, что это такоеза.Это может быть полезно для тестирования производительности или восстановления данных.В нашем случае нам нужно проверить некоторые данные в базе данных, используя наши журналы, потому что у БД могут возникнуть проблемы с целостностью данных.

Ответы [ 2 ]

0 голосов
/ 18 марта 2011

HTTP Raw Request для JMeter может помочь с этим

0 голосов
/ 02 марта 2011

Я смотрю на paper_trail , чтобы получить такую ​​функциональность в будущем. Для приложения, о котором идет речь, мы должны были выполнить тяжелый анализ логов, чтобы получить нужные нам результаты. Он включал в себя разделение действий по IP-адресу (таким образом, аналогично сеансам, хотя некоторые IP-адреса содержали несколько пользовательских сеансов) и анализ действий и параметров в журналах. Он не был на 100% эффективен при воспроизведении точного состояния базы данных, но это было довольно близко.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...